通过对模糊层次分析(FAHP)法的阐述,结合具体矿山实例,对模糊层次分析法在地下矿山开拓系统方案优化中的应用进行了探讨.选定了7种与开拓系统选择密切相关的技术经济指标作为准则层元素,并与目标层、方案层共同组成层次分析模型,最终把开拓系统优化选择归结为各层次间的相对重要性权值的确定或相对优劣次序的排序问题,从而使定性分析的问题转化为定量分析,结果表明该方法是可行的.%Fuzzy Analytic Hierarchy Process (FAHP) was described and its application in the optimization of underground mine development system was discussed by relating to some mine examples.Seven technical-economic indicators closely related to development system were chosen as criterion layer elements and then serve as a part of analytic hierarchy model together with destination layer and project layer.And it was finally concluded that the optimization selection of development system was dependent on the determination of the relative significant priority and quality sequence of layers.By doing so,the qualitative analysis was transformed into quantitative analysis.Results show that this method is feasible.
